How to reset radio / audio system
I have a 07 335 with nav. Once in a while after starting my car, I don't get any audio from my speakers. This includes radio, iPod, Bluetooth, or backup sensor warning. No audio period. Once this happens, the sound will remain off until the next morning. I was told by my dealer that the car does a reset after 4 hours or so which is why it works the next day. Is there a way I can force it to reset sooner?

some radios holding power and eject at the same time for 20-30 seconds will reset it.
